After becoming champion of Master Chef Celebrity (Telefe), Mica Viciconte continues to be at the center of controversy. As told in show partners (El Trece, at 11), Nicole Neumann is disgusted that she won the reality show Her three daughters along with Fabián Poroto Cubero, her current partner and father of the son she will have in early May, were identified as her “daughters“.

Today, Mica Viciconte claims to use that term, despite Nicole’s regret. in the cycle In case (La Once Diez/Radio Ciudad), started by saying the fact that his partner’s kids accompanied him to the MasterChef final was something he really enjoyed.

It is 100 percent important that they are there … And going through this entire pregnancy together, because they also live here, and being told ‘we want to go’ was super important, ”said Viciconte.

On the other hand, he was amazed that Cubero’s three children -Indiana, Allegra and Sienna- endured the long hours involved in recording the cooking reality show led by Santiago Del Moro.

“They banked it. The older brother was a little embarrassed but Santi (Del Moro) had a field and told him that ‘if you want to come in, come in. I have nothing to ask you. And I saved that he kept it, ”said Mica.

Referring to her relationship with her partner’s daughters, she said: “I think so when someone gives love without asking for anything in return, it flows … And they made it easy for me. I adore them. I have lived four and a half years, almost five, and we spend a lot of time. And now a brother is coming. they are my family”.
